Following a demanding selection process, Cruden Property Services is delighted to have been chosen by Harvest Housing Group as its maintenance and property services partner for the new 'Repairs Partnership Project', which is to take place in three areas - Eavesbrook (covering Preston and Lancashire), 'Manchester East' and 'Manchester West'.
The project, which comprises day-to-day fabric maintenance and property services, is valued at £3million
per year over the five year contract period and is a major achievement for CPSL. "Our offering to Harvest provided benefits in every area of activity." confirmed Operations Manager Chris Pugh. "Our innovative IT packages, our ability to communicate with operatives in the field and our creative approach to tenant communications and participation all gained approval from the Harvest evaluation team."
